WAYBACK MACHINE (USA) DEC 2002 OK, so when The Hot Pockets released their excellent "Mess of Fire" LP on Screaming Apple/Stolen Records, very few people really took notice. I remember reading maybe one glowing review before hunting it down myself. I was satisfied. "Not damned bad!" I'd say to myself as I'd spill beer on my shirt. That was the first time (I heard the record, not drank beer). Then on subsequent spins the record really started to grow on me. I like Hot Pockets for lunch AND for desert! Well, then this baby ("Kiss 'n Run") arrived in my mailbox. It's a new LP, but not new recordings. This is a collection of singles and previously unreleased tracks recorded even before the "Mess of Fire" sessions. Supposedly The Hot Pockets only lasted 8 weeks before calling it quits. Holy crap! 8 weeks!! I know bands that have been together and practiced for 8 MONTHS before even getting their first gig, much less releasing two full-length slabs of vinyl! This is switchblade rock'n'roll. Heavy on the distortion, loud, loose, and savage. Tuneful, melodic, and with just the right amount of unpretentiousness and ineptitude you'd really wanna hear in a new "teen" band. No idea how old these guys are. Who fuckin' cares? They're gone now. But you owe it to yourself to own this sucker.(kopper)

HIGH HEELS SLUTS (BELGIUM) SEP 2002 Well, this one turned out really nice! From the sleeve, the blue vinyl and the cute zine to -and that's the most important of course- the music. If you're unfamiliar with the band and its members' past occupations, let me just tell you the Hot Pockets consist of ex-STIPJES and SPACESHITS members and a current FIREBIRDS /KRONTJUNG DEVILS, so you know you're in for a real R'n'R deal. Thirteen shots of raw, harsh and unpolished rawk'n'roll trash shot right up your veins, delivering the same treatment as any PAGANS or DRAGS record does! And they're a thrill, you know?! Only remark I have about this -their 2nd- allbum is that 4 songs are taken off earlier 7"s and 2 have different takes on their "Mess Of Fire" debut album, so that only leaves us with 7 brand new tunes. But if you aren't around from day one you'd better forget about this remark and try to get your hands on this one. Welcome to Rock'n'Roll city!!(wim)

UP YOURS! (BELGIUM) MAY 2002 Like "Kiss'n Run", the second full album by THE HOT POCKETS from Groningen (formerly known as Hollands 'Rock City #1'). Nowadays times have changed and only bands like The KRONTJUNG DEVILS and The WAITCOATS are still holding the Groninger banner. But offcourse there's HOT POCKETS, a band which started off as a one-time project of Robert (ex-STIPJES) and his Canadian buddy Adam G. (ex-SPACESHITS). Both shared a similar addiction for punked-up R'n'roll songs and discovered the thought the same about R'n'Roll history's important bands (5 'Originators' seemed more than enough!!) After a couple of 7"s on local European labels and a first lp on Screamin' Apple came this second, vinyl-only album. "Kiss'n Run" 13 tracks of sizzling, irresistable Rock'n Roll tunes with a delightful mixture of powerpop, a dashing punkdrive and an uptempo catchyness. The present songs are a selection out of several recordings and some tracks were already featured on previous 7"s since the recordings date back from before their first lp recordings. THE HOT POCKETS tunes are full-on high energy R'n'roll spreading the overall aura of lovely loud, frenzied and wild guitars, which never loose touch with the basics of the songs. CLASSIC!! (bo)
